Zil Cultural Center is a vibrant landmark in Moscow's Danilovskiy district, housed in a striking constructivist building originally built as a workers' club. Today, it serves as a hub for contemporary culture, offering a diverse program of art exhibitions, concerts, theater performances, film screenings, and workshops. The interior features modern galleries, a concert hall, and creative spaces that retain the building's industrial character. Visitors can explore rotating exhibitions of Russian and international artists, attend live music events, or participate in educational activities. The center also has a café and a bookstore, making it a great place to spend a few hours. Its distinctive architecture and lively atmosphere make it a must-visit for culture enthusiasts.

历史背景

The building was constructed in the 1930s as a cultural center for workers of the Likhachev Automobile Plant (ZIL). Designed by the Vesnin brothers, it is a masterpiece of Soviet constructivist architecture. After a period of decline, it was renovated and reopened as a contemporary cultural venue.

Is Zil Cultural Center free to enter?

The building and some exhibitions are free. Paid events (concerts, performances) require tickets.

What kind of events are held there?

The center hosts art exhibitions, concerts, theater, film screenings, lectures, and workshops for all ages.

How do I get there by metro?

Take the metro to Avtozavodskaya station (Zamoskvoretskaya line), then walk about 10 minutes east along Vostochnaya Street.
